The Engineer Sr position holds the responsibility for the safe, reliable, and economic round‑the‑clock operation of the generation, electric transmission, and distribution systems. Duties include Engineering responsibilities for the design, construction, maintenance, and operation activities of our power plants, transmission lines, substations, distribution system, gas systems, control centers and others. These Engineering duties may include continuous monitoring and balancing of energy flow and responding to system disturbances, along with all generation, distribution, and transmission activities that provide electric and gas services to customers.
This role will also support highly cross‑functional planning and system strategy initiatives in a dynamic and evolving environment. The Engineer will partner across generation, transmission, distribution, gas, forecasting, finance, regulatory, and operations functions to evaluate complex technical information, support long‑range system planning efforts, and help develop practical, data‑informed recommendations that improve reliability, cost effectiveness, and operational readiness. Success in this role requires comfort working through ambiguity, building processes, and helping shape new or evolving programs from the ground up.
